Использование WUA с удаленного компьютера
API агента клиентский компонент Центра обновления Windows (WUA) может использоваться пользователем на удаленном компьютере или приложением, работающим на удаленном компьютере. Однако удаленный пользователь или приложение должны иметь права администратора.
В следующем списке содержатся интерфейсы, доступные удаленным пользователям и приложениям.
- IUpdateSession
- IUpdateSession2
- IUpdateSearcher
- IAutomaticUpdates
- ISearchResult
- IUpdateCollection
- IUpdate
- IUpdate2
- IWindowsDriverUpdate
- IWindowsDriverUpdate2
- IUpdateIdentity
- IImageInformation
- IInstallationBehavior
- IStringCollection
- IUpdateHistoryEntryCollection
- IUpdateHistoryEntry
- ICategoryCollection
- ICategory
- IUpdateExceptionCollection
- IUpdateException
- IUpdateDownloadContentCollection
- IUpdateDownloadContent
- IUpdateServiceManager
- IUpdateServiceCollection
- IUpdateService
- IWindowsUpdateAgentInfo
В следующем списке содержатся интерфейсы и свойства, недоступные для удаленных пользователей и приложений.
- IUpdateSession::CreateUpdateDownloader
- IUpdateSession::CreateUpdateInstaller
- Свойство WebProxy объекта IUpdateSession
- IUpdateSearcher::BeginSearch
- IUpdateSearcher::EndSearch
- IsHidden Property of IUpdate (IsHidden доступен только для чтения при удаленном вызове).)
- IUpdate::AcceptEula
- IUpdate::CopyFromCache
- IUpdate2::CopyToCache
- IWindowsDriverUpdate2::CopyToCache
- IUpdateServiceManager::AddService
- IUpdateServiceManager::RegisterServiceWithAU
- IUpdateServiceManager::UnregisterServiceWithAU
- IAutomaticUpdate::P ause
- IAutomaticUpdates::Resume
- IAutomaticUpdates::ShowSettingsDialog
- Свойство Settings объекта IAutomaticUpdates
- Свойство ServiceEnabled объекта IAutomaticUpdates
- IAutomaticUpdates::EnableService
- ISystemInformation
Для удаленного вызова API WUA в параметры брандмауэра Windows для Windows Vista и Windows Server 2008 необходимо добавить следующие порты и исключения.
-
Исключение 1
-
- Локальный порт: 135
- Удаленный порт: ALL
- Номер протокола: 6
- Исполняемый файл: %windir%\\system32\\svchost.exe
- Служба: rpcss
- Удаленные привилегии: администратор
-
Исключение 2
-
- Локальный порт: динамический RPC
- Удаленный порт: ALL
- Номер протокола: 6
- Исполняемый файл: %windir%\\system32\\dllhost.exe
- Удаленные привилегии: администратор
В следующем списке содержатся средства, которые можно использовать для настройки параметров брандмауэра Windows.
- Брандмауэр Windows с оснасткой «Повышенная безопасность».
- Групповая политика
- Программа командной строки Netsh advfirewall
Дополнительные сведения об использовании средств для настройки параметров брандмауэра Windows см. в статье начало работы с брандмауэром Windows в режиме повышенной безопасности.